BACHELOR OF COMPUTER SCIENCE (HONOURS)
Course Description
The Bachelor of Computer Science (Honours) program is meticulously designed to meet the evolving demands of the computing and technology industries. It serves as a cornerstone for developing application systems, fostering problem-solving capabilities, and innovating computer technologies across various fields globally. This program not only equips students with theoretical knowledge but also practical skills needed to address complex challenges in today’s technology-driven world.
The curriculum is structured to provide a strong foundation in essential computer science disciplines, including programming, algorithms, data structures, and computer systems. Students are also exposed to advanced topics such as artificial intelligence, cybersecurity, and software engineering, ensuring they are well-prepared for dynamic industry requirements. The integration of multidisciplinary knowledge allows students to bridge computing with other fields like business, healthcare, and engineering, creating diverse opportunities for growth and innovation.
By emphasizing real-world applications, the program encourages students to develop practical expertise through practical sessions, internships, and collaborative projects. These experiences are pivotal for honing skills in designing, developing, and managing technology solutions, which are highly valued in the marketplace. With strong industry partnerships, students gain insights into the latest trends and technologies, preparing them for leadership roles in the tech industry.
Graduates from this program emerge as innovative thinkers and ethical professionals, capable of contributing to advancements in computing for the betterment of society. The program fosters critical thinking, effective communication, and teamwork skills, ensuring graduates are not just competent technologists but also impactful contributors to their communities and organizations.
This comprehensive degree serves as a gateway to numerous career opportunities, from software development to IT consulting, empowering students to shape the future of technology and address global challenges with innovative solutions.
- Platform Technologies: Students learn the fundamentals of essential platform technologies in the IT world.
- Programming Essentials: This course focuses on the basics of programming and software development.
- Industry-Led Modules: Modules designed in collaboration with the industry to ensure students gain current and relevant knowledge.
Hands-On Skills and Practical Projects:
- Final Year Project: Students are required to complete a project that integrates all the skills learned throughout the program.
- Industrial Training: Students are given the opportunity to undergo industrial training at leading companies, providing real-world experience.
Career Opportunities and Employability: :
- Career Prospects: Graduates of this program can enter various fields such as software development, networking, information security, and more.
- Employability: This program is designed to meet the needs of the growing ICT industry.
Co-Curricular Activities and Soft Skills Development:
- Co-Curricular Activities: Students engage in co-curricular activities that help develop soft skills such as communication and leadership.
- Inventive Problem Solving: Courses that help students hone their creative problem-solving skills.
Recognition and Accreditation:
- MQA Accreditation: This program is accredited by the Malaysian Qualifications Agency (MQA), ensuring high-quality education.
- A pass in Sijil Tinggi Persekolahan Malaysia (STPM) with a minimum Grade C of Grade Point (GP) in any subject or equivalent qualification and a credit in Mathematics at SPM level or its equivalent; OR
- A pass in Sijil Tinggi Agama Malaysia (STAM) with a minimum grade of Maqbul (pass) and a credit in Mathematics at SPM level or its equivalent; OR
- Possess Sijil Kemahiran Malaysia (SKM) Level 3 in a related field and a credit in Mathematics at SPM level or its equivalent.
- Certificate [Level 3, Malaysian Qualifications Framework (MQF) in a related field with at least a Cumulative Grade Point Average (CGPA) of 2. 00; OR
- Other relevant & equivalent qualifications recognised by the Malaysian Government.
- Local tuition fee: RM18,410
- International tuition fee: RM29,655
- Demonstrate proficiency in industry-standard software and tools, able to apply design and architecture to Information Technology solutions using appropriate tools and techniques.
- Demonstrate a strong understanding of core IT concepts, including programming, networking, and information security
- Demonstrate the ability to apply technical skills in real-world scenarios through hands-on projects and industrial training.
- Demonstrate the ability to work effectively in teams, collaborating with designers, developers, and other professionals to complete projects efficiently and creatively.
- Assistant System Analyst
- Database Administrator
- Web Designer/Developer
- Information System Officer
- IT Consultant
- System Development Officer
- Help Desk Officer
Course Info
- DURATION: 2 ½ Years
- TUITION FEES:
Local: RM18,410
International: RM29,655 - MQA:
KPM/JPT (R3/0611/4/0065) 06/24 (A5917)


